Blepharitis & Autoimmunity: What You Need to Know
Blepharitis, a common disorder affecting the eyelid margins , often presents with a surprising association to immune-mediated diseases . Research suggests that blepharitis isn't always purely an hygiene-related problem; it can be a symptom of a larger internal defense mechanism dysfunction. Some autoimmune disorders , such as rheumatoid arthritis , are frequently associated with blepharitis, suggesting a possible underlying cause . It's vital for people experiencing recurring blepharitis to explore this conceivable relationship with their physician , especially if they suffer from other symptoms of an autoimmune disease .

Simple Solutions for Eyelid Inflammation
Dealing with blepharitis can be uncomfortable, but thankfully, several gentle home remedies can offer soothing and help manage the condition . A warm compress is often the first step; soak a soft cloth in heated water and apply it to your sealed eyelids for 10-15 moments each day. Cleaning with a gentle soap solution – typically a quarter teaspoonful in 4 fluid ounces of warm water – is also very effective . Here’s a quick summary to get you started:
- Place heated cloths
- Do gentle eyelid scrubs
- Ensure everything tools are sanitary
Note that such home solutions are meant to offer symptom relief and won't always cure the underlying cause of blepharitis . See a ophthalmologist if your condition get worse or don’t clear up with this approach .
